Output 21fed84380ea5a6ee65fa15a4f2aa8ca41676ea625f1fe2358c4b64774023b56:20

value
51967346
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 288cb3229ea13d15443dc22f097e57727197df50 OP_EQUALVERIFY OP_CHECKSIG
address
14hQafTQnjgRo5Q31S8bJZN8CMAkSm9vNg
transaction
21fed84380ea5a6ee65fa15a4f2aa8ca41676ea625f1fe2358c4b64774023b56
spent
true